Reengineering Access Approvals

Robinhood's revamped process prioritizes both security and speed. By utilizing an engineering-first approach, they have streamlined the way developers access sensitive systems. Here are some key aspects of their new method:

  • Automated Workflows: Automation plays a crucial role in minimizing manual oversight, reducing the time needed to grant approvals.
  • Role-Based Access Control: Ensuring that developers only have access to the systems necessary for their roles enhances both security and efficiency.
  • Continuous Feedback Loops: Regular feedback from developers helps refine the process, making it more intuitive and user-friendly.

Lessons Learned from the Transformation

Robinhood's experience offers valuable insights for other organizations looking to enhance their access approval processes. Here are the main lessons that can be gleaned:

1. Collaboration is Key

Encouraging collaboration between engineering teams and security personnel ensures that both perspectives are considered during the reengineering phase. This holistic approach leads to solutions that are both secure and user-friendly.

2. Embrace Technology

Investing in technology that supports automation and monitoring can yield significant benefits. Leveraging advanced tools helps streamline tasks that were previously time-consuming and prone to error, thus allowing developers to focus on their core project work.
